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Queens Park (London) to Ashford International start from £40.10 one way, or £40.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Queens Park (London) to Ashford International are available for £42.00 one way, or £45.00 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Comfort at Queens Park

This station is equipped with ticket machines to accommodate all your ticketing needs, whether you're collecting tickets ordered online or purchasing new ones for an adventurous jaunt. While the station lacks a ticket office, the accessible ticket machines can certainly assist with Underground service tickets, including handy options like daily and weekly Travelcards.

For additional assistance, staff help is readily available from Monday to Sunday. The station is also fitted with help points and benefits from CCTV surveillance, ensuring a safe and well-monitored environment for its users. Although the station lacks some amenities such as step-free access and toilets, it does provide seating areas and waiting rooms on its island platforms, making it a comfortable stop along your route.

Modern Facilities and Amenities

Stepping into Ashford International, travelers are greeted with modern, accessible facilities designed to make the journey as seamless as possible. The station offers extensive ticketing options, including a ticket office open from the early hours of 5:30 am until 9:30 pm, Monday through Saturday, and a slightly later start at 6:00 am on Sundays. Ticket machines are widely available for self-service, with provisions for accessibility.

For those needing special assistance, Ashford International offers comprehensive support, including an induction loop, customer help points, and step-free access across the entire station. Waiting rooms and shelters provide comfort, with heated facilities on select platforms, while seating areas cater to travelers needing a respite between connections.
